The DVE Team

Collaboration is a key component of the philosophy here at Double Vision Editorial, and as DVE grows, so does its expert team. Whether DVE has a busy month of projects, fresh eyes are needed for an edit in a multi-pass project (a copy edit after content edits, for example), or a project requires special expertise, DVE works with only the most trusted and skilled independent contractors.

DVE has a firm subcontractor policy, and no work will be subcontracted without a client's advance written consent. Danielle works closely with her team, as well, collaborating with editors on style choices, content questions, etcetera. Danielle is also the direct contact for all clients when a subcontractor is brought into the mix, so clients can sit back and relax, knowing that their work is in the best hands.

Shannon Godwin

Developmental Editing, Line Editing, Manuscript Reviews

Shannon Godwin has been in book publishing for over sixteen years, working in editorial, sales, marketing, and production for many major houses. As an editor, her books have been published by Entangled, Harlequin, and Amazon/Montlake. Many have gone on to be New York Times bestsellers, and several have received RITA® nominations. Her sales and marketing experience includes Random House, Penguin, Simon & Schuster, and Macmillan, where she managed many key retail accounts and publishing clients for both the adult and children's divisions. Mike McConnell

Copy Editing, Proofreading, Cold Reading

Mike is a full-time freelance editor, proofreader, and cold reader. He has been the editor of award-winning literature and NYT bestsellers, and has seven years' experience working with Penguin Random House and Hachette. You can find him on Facebook as @copyeditormike.

Lorrie G. Noggle

All Services

Lorrie G. Noggle has over a decade of professional writing and editing experience, having worked for Thomas Dunne Books/St. Martin’s Press, Jacobs Engineering, Girl Scouts of the USA, and the Peace Operations Training Institute. In addition to her full-time job as a senior writer/editor for JA Worldwide, Lorrie works as a freelance editor and writing coach for Double Vision Editorial. Originally from Alaska, Lorrie currently lives in Richmond, Virginia, with her husband, cat, and dog. When she’s not working, she enjoys gardening, baking, and reading, and she tries to get outside as much as possible. She also serves as a Girl Scout troop leader for a mixed-level troop of more than thirty Daisies, Brownies, and Juniors, and volunteers as co-chair for her local Hollins alumnae chapter.
